In observance of National Preparedness Month, the Emergency Management Agency said it will publish guidance videos and advised residents to plan for 10 to 14 days of supplies, designate a family meeting spot and rehearse evacuation plans, EMA Director Sean Granato said.

September is National Preparedness Month, and the Emergency Management Agency urged residents to plan and practice household emergency procedures and stock supplies for an extended period. A staff member said the agency will roll out videos this month covering what to include in a ready kit, how to create a communication plan and disaster recovery.
